Write the complaint in an unemotional way. Don't make personal attacks on the staff you are complaining about ? stick to complaining about the aspects of their behaviour that are unacceptable. State the outcome you're hoping for. This could be simply an apology and an undertaking to behave differently in the future.
The format of a complaint letter follows the format of a formal letter. To write a complaint letter, you can start with the sender's address followed by the date, the receiver's address, the subject, salutation, body of the letter, complimentary closing, signature and name in block letters.
You can simply address them as "Mayor" followed by their last name in most instances. For example: Dear Mayor Barry. Follow your salutation with a comma, double space, and continue with your letter. Double-check proper protocol outside the US.
In letters: ?Dear Sir/Madam? or ?Dear Mr./Madam Mayor?. Inside address for letters and envelopes: ?His/Her Worship (name), Mayor of (municipality)?.
